Maison >développement back-end >tutoriel php >Comment convertir les clés d'un tableau en minuscules en PHP ?
Convertir les clés du tableau en minuscules en PHP, nous pouvons le faire facilement sans utiliser de boucles. Nous avons juste besoin d'utiliser array_change_key_case(). La fonction array_change_key_case a deux paramètres, l'un est un tableau et l'autre peut être la constante "CASE_LOWER", nous devrons donc peut-être le faire lors de la réalisation de grands projets.
Ce qui suit explique comment utiliser array_change_key_case() pour convertir les valeurs d'un tableau en minuscules.
L'exemple de code PHP est le suivant :
<?php $myArray = ['Hey'=>'Hey','HELLO'=>'Hello','hi'=>'Hi','Gm'=>'GM']; $result = array_change_key_case($myArray, CASE_LOWER); print_r($result);
Sortie :
Array Array ( [hey] => Hey [hello] => Hello [hi] => Hi [gm] => GM )
Comme indiqué ci-dessus, les clés du tableau associatif sont convertis en minuscules.
Introduction à la fonction :
array_change_key_case() change tous les noms de clés du tableau en majuscules ou en minuscules
array_change_key_case ( array $array [, int $case = CASE_LOWER ] ) : array
array_change_key_case() sera tout les noms de clés dans le tableau sont remplacés par des minuscules ou des majuscules. Cette fonction ne modifie pas l'index numérique.
Paramètres :
array, le tableau sur lequel opérer.
cas, vous pouvez utiliser ici deux constantes, CASE_UPPER ou CASE_LOWER (valeur par défaut).
Valeur de retour, renvoie un tableau dont les clés sont toutes en minuscules ou toutes en majuscules ; si la valeur d'entrée (tableau) n'est pas un tableau, renvoie FALSE
Remarque : si la valeur d'entrée (tableau) ) n'est pas Un tableau lancera un avertissement d'erreur (E_WARNING).
Recommandations associées : "Comment convertir les valeurs d'un tableau en minuscules en PHP ? 》
Cet article est une introduction à la méthode de conversion des clés de tableau en minuscules en PHP. Il est simple et facile à comprendre. J'espère qu'il sera utile aux amis dans le besoin !
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!